This is a noteworthy commercial property situated in the vibrant town centre of Keswick, featuring a collection of six holiday cottages and apartments that currently serve as luxury rentals. The premises are set within an ample plot that includes a large parking area, an internal courtyard, landscaped gardens, and a tennis court, presenting significant potential for further development or enhancement. Each unit has been crafted to provide distinct living spaces ranging from one to four bedrooms, all equipped with private parking and utility access alongside shared gardens.
Of particular interest is the historic Bridge House, which dates back to 1727 and offers spacious accommodation over three floors while preserving its original charm. It includes modern amenities and several en-suite facilities. The additional cottages feature inviting elements like log-burning stoves and sociable kitchen-diners conducive to both relaxation and entertaining.
Notably, the detached double garage may present opportunities for conversion or expansion (subject to planning permissions), adding desirability to this investment proposition. Given the proximity to local amenities and attractions such as Derwent Water, this property stands as an attractive base for visitors.
While all cottages have recently undergone renovation to create high-quality rental options, prospective buyers may find room for additional value-adding improvements considering previous water damage during Storm Desmond in 2015.
